How to Use Yahoo Search Effectively
Okay, so you're intrigued and want to give Yahoo Search a try. Here are some tips on how to use it effectively:
- Use Specific Keywords: The more specific you are with your keywords, the more relevant your search results will be. Instead of searching for "restaurant," try searching for "Italian restaurant in Munich."
 - Use Quotes for Exact Phrases: If you're looking for an exact phrase, enclose it in quotes. For example, searching for "best pizza in Berlin" will only return results that contain that exact phrase.
 - Use the Minus Sign to Exclude Words: If you want to exclude certain words from your search results, use the minus sign (-) before the word. For example, searching for "jaguar -car" will return results about the animal jaguar, but not the car.
 - Use the Site: Operator to Search a Specific Website: If you want to search for something on a specific website, use the site: operator followed by the website's URL. For example, searching for "site:wikipedia.org quantum physics" will only return results from Wikipedia about quantum physics.
 - Explore Advanced Search Options: Yahoo offers advanced search options that allow you to refine your search by language, region, file type, and more.
 
By using these tips, you can get the most out of Yahoo Search and find the information you're looking for quickly and easily.
